Analysis

Malaysia recorded 13.34 years for school life expectancy, primary to tertiary, male in 2017.

That represents a change of down 1.0% on the previous year and up 11.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, school life expectancy, primary to tertiary, male in Malaysia peaked at 13.48 years in 2016 and was at its lowest, 9.36 years, in 1980.

Malaysia ranks 88th of 175 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 27 years of available data.

Expected years of schooling is the number of years a child of school entrance age is expected to spend at school, or university, including years spent on repetition. It is the sum of the age-specific enrolment ratios for primary, secondary, post-secondary non-tertiary and tertiary education.
